BLOCKCHAIN × AI

PoAI (Proof of Artificial Intelligence)

Building PoAI Trust Verification Models for AI Reasoning Processes

Making AI decision-making processes transparent and verifiable on blockchain. Through the new consensus mechanism of Proof of Artificial Intelligence, we cryptographically prove AI judgment bases and build next-generation systems that ensure reliability on distributed networks.

SPACE × AI

Space-Type Autonomous AI Agents

Development of Space-Type Autonomous AI Agents Adapted to Space Environments

AI systems that independently judge and act in the extreme environment of space. Realizing autonomous problem-solving under communication delays and resource constraints, and efficiency in space exploration missions. We develop innovative platforms that technically support humanity's space expansion with next-generation space AI that combines radiation resistance and low-power design.
